Specialists
Watchlist
Ratings
Zizie Zidane
Actor
2020
[
]
May the Devil Take You Too
(Leo Kecil)
2022
[
]
The Doll 3
(Gian)
2023
[
]
Late Night Paranormal Shenanigans
(Zidan)
💀
credits.md